Factors Affecting Cost
Replacing a roof on a TPO (Thermoplastic Polyolefin) system in Douglas, MA, involves several factors that influence the overall project scope and cost. Understanding typical project components can help homeowners compare options and plan accordingly. This overview provides general insights into what is involved in a TPO roof replacement in the area.
- Materials: TPO roofing membranes are commonly used for their durability and energy efficiency, with options varying in thickness and quality.
- Size and Scope: The project size depends on the roof's square footage, complexity of the layout, and any additional features such as vents or skylights.
- Labor Complexity: Installation involves removing existing roofing layers, preparing the substrate, and ensuring proper sealing and fastening, which can vary based on roof design.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Douglas, MA, may require permits for roof replacement, especially if structural modifications are involved.
- Extras: Additional components such as insulation upgrades, flashing repairs, or warranty options may influence overall project costs and scope.
